Your Role
Reporting to the QAQC Manager, you will play a key role in our QAQC division. As our QAQC Technician, you will possess the ability to learn and apply company methods, practices, procedures and regulatory requirements regarding the installation of modern plumbing and hydronics systems. You will be responsible for completing QAQC for Enersolv’s commercial projects while providing detailed reporting and documentation. You will be expected to demonstrate a high level of communication and dedication to our foremen, superintendents and project managers. You will be expected to collaborate with site teams and ensure proper installation of suite plumbing and remain invested in the site’s overall success until completion.
Being punctual, flexible and personable will be a daily expectation as a QAQC representative of Enersolv.
Responsibilities
- Complete pre-board and fixture commissioning checklists and inspections
- Read drawings, pre-diagnose conflict, and recommend solutions
- Perform QAQC duties that are tailored to the Site Foreman’s liking
- Demonstrate high quality installation to site crews with a positive attitude
- Educate site teams with QAQC expectations & processes
- Perform all duties within the site schedule
- Provide improvements as needed with commercial and residential plumbing, fixture installations
- Write detailed reports with photo documentation
- Ensure projects are up to building and plumbing code
- Build rough-in and finishing packages for site teams.
Skills and Qualifications
· 8-10 years experience on residential and commercial projects:
o High rise domestic water systems
o High rise hydronic systems
o A strong understanding of Procore & Sitedocs
o Gas knowledge & experience
· Plumbing or Gas-fitting Red Seal Ticket
· Level 1 First Aid (considered an asset)
· Workplace Hazardous Materials Information System (WHMIS) (considered an asset)
· Possess personal hand tools for the trade. Enersolv will provide any additional company-related tools.
· Valid BC Class 5 driver’s license
